A leading kitchen supplier in Scotland seeks a Kitchen Sales Designer to assist Trade customers in creating dream kitchens. This role involves understanding customer visions, providing expert advice, and negotiating design details.
Prior sales experience and a driving license are essential, while CAD experience is preferred.
The company offers competitive pay, bonuses, and extensive training through their Howdens Academy. Join a supportive and dynamic team focused on excellent customer experiences.
